What lowers a forklift mast?

Attached to the carriage are the forks. The carriage is actuated by the hydraulic piston in the middle of the mast. By pulling the mast lever on the cowl it raises the load by actuating that piston, thus lifting the forks and your load. All masts lift by hydraulic displacement and lower by the force of gravity.

How does a forklift mast work?

As you may already know, a forklift uses hydraulic pressure to raise the mast up by raising the lift cylinders. This, in turn, raises the inner mast channels, but without the lift chains, your forks and carriage aren’t going anywhere. And if your forks aren’t being lifted, you aren’t going to be getting much work done.

What is forklift mast height?

Lift Height: (also known as maximum fork height or MFH) tells you how high the forks will be with the mast fully extended. When choosing a forklift mast, add at least six inches to the height of your topmost racking shelf. This will allow your operators to safely adjust loads when the mast is fully extended.

What affects forklift stability?

Determining a forklift’s safe load capacity The load weight, weight distribution, size, shape, and position are key factors affecting the capacity and the stability of the forklift. Capacity may be reduced with irregularly shaped loads, unbalanced weight distribution, or if the load is not centered on the forks.

What are the three points of stability on a forklift?

The three points are the two front wheels and the pivot point of the rear axle. Connect the three points, and you have what’s called the stability triangle.

Why forklift is dangerous?

There are many factors that explain why forklifts are dangerous: Forklifts are heavy. The weight of a forklift is unevenly distributed, which makes it harder to operate and drive. The rear wheels of a forklift are responsible for turning the vehicle, increasing the chances of tipping during tight turns.

How dangerous is a forklift job?

Common Forklift Job Dangers The vehicle crashing into another object or vehicle. Objects falling from lift trucks onto staff and/or visitors. Lift trucks toppling over onto staff/and or visitors. People falling from the truck or other parts of the vehicle.

What is a safe speed for a forklift?

The Material Handling Equipment Distributors Association (MHEDA) recommends a max speed of 8 mph in general and a 3 mph max speed in areas where pedestrians are present.

How many feet does it take a forklift to stop?

If a forklift is going 4 mph, it’s going to need about 17 feet or more to stop. The driver will usually travel about 7 feet before he or she has time to apply the brakes (and that’s assuming that the driver is paying close attention to his surroundings, which is not usually the case).

What are the 3 pedals on a forklift for?

To begin with, every forklift comes equipped with an accelerator and a brake pedal. That third pedal is called an Inching Brake. Its function is twofold. It initially acts as a brake and secondly disengages the transmission, allowing the engine speed to increase or decrease without affecting the drive of the forklift.
